<h3>What is photosynthesis?</h3>

The photosynthesis is a process that occurs in the chloroplast organelle of the plant cells. The typical light reaction of the photosynthesis takes place inside the thylakoid membrane of the chloroplast.

The chief reactants such as water and carbon dioxide participate in the reaction. The water gets oxidized in the reaction to release the oxygen as a product. The carbon dioxide get reduced.

Thus, Photosynthesis requires the products from respiration, and respiration requires the products from photosynthesis.
